slyfox 15/08/01 21:42:46
Modified: haddock-2.10.0-r2.ebuild haddock-2.13.1-r2.ebuild
haddock-2.13.2-r1.ebuild ChangeLog
Log:
Put upper bound on ghc version for older packages.
(Portage version: 2.2.20/cvs/Linux x86_64, signed Manifest commit with key
611FF3AA)
Revision Changes Path
1.11 dev-haskell/haddock/haddock-2.10.0-r2.ebuild
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.10.0-r2.ebuild?rev=1.11&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.10.0-r2.ebuild?rev=1.11&content-type=text/plain
diff :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.10.0-r2.ebuild?r1=1.10&r2=1.11
Index: haddock-2.10.0-r2.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.10.0-r2.ebuild,v
retrieving revision 1.10
retrieving revision 1.11
diff -u -r1.10 -r1.11
--- haddock-2.10.0-r2.ebuild 2 Jan 2015 23:16:40 -0000 1.10
+++ haddock-2.10.0-r2.ebuild 1 Aug 2015 21:42:46 -0000 1.11
@@ -1,6 +1,6 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header:
/var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.10.0-r2.ebuild,v 1.10
2015/01/02 23:16:40 slyfox Exp $
+# $Header:
/var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.10.0-r2.ebuild,v 1.11
2015/08/01 21:42:46 slyfox Exp $
EAPI="4"
@@ -13,19 +13,20 @@
LICENSE="BSD"
SLOT="0"
+# ia64 lost as we don't have ghc-7 there yet
# ppc64 needs to be rekeyworded due to xhtml not being keyworded
KEYWORDS="alpha amd64 ia64 ppc ppc64 sparc x86 ~x86-fbsd ~x86-freebsd
~amd64-linux ~x86-linux ~x86-macos ~x86-solaris"
IUSE=""
RDEPEND="dev-haskell/ghc-paths[profile?]
=dev-haskell/xhtml-3000.2*[profile?]
- >=dev-lang/ghc-7.4 <dev-lang/ghc-7.6"
+ >=dev-lang/ghc-7.4"
DEPEND="${RDEPEND}
>=dev-haskell/cabal-1.14"
RESTRICT="test" # avoid depends on QC
-CABAL_EXTRA_BUILD_FLAGS="--ghc-options=-rtsopts"
+CABAL_EXTRA_BUILD_FLAGS+=" --ghc-options=-rtsopts"
src_prepare() {
# we would like to avoid happy and alex depends
1.2 dev-haskell/haddock/haddock-2.13.1-r2.ebuild
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.13.1-r2.ebuild?rev=1.2&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.13.1-r2.ebuild?rev=1.2&content-type=text/plain
diff :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.13.1-r2.ebuild?r1=1.1&r2=1.2
Index: haddock-2.13.1-r2.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.13.1-r2.ebuild,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- haddock-2.13.1-r2.ebuild 10 Feb 2013 14:23:03 -0000 1.1
+++ haddock-2.13.1-r2.ebuild 1 Aug 2015 21:42:46 -0000 1.2
@@ -1,6 +1,6 @@
-# Copyright 1999-2013 Gentoo Foundation
+#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header:
/var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.13.1-r2.ebuild,v 1.1
2013/02/10 14:23:03 slyfox Exp $
+# $Header:
/var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.13.1-r2.ebuild,v 1.2
2015/08/01 21:42:46 slyfox Exp $
EAPI=5
@@ -15,18 +15,18 @@
SLOT="0/${PV}"
# ia64 lost as we don't have ghc-7 there yet
# ppc64 needs to be rekeyworded due to xhtml not being keyworded
-KEYWORDS="~amd64 ~x86"
+KEYWORDS="~alpha ~amd64 -ia64 ~ppc ~sparc ~x86 ~x86-fbsd"
IUSE=""
RDEPEND="dev-haskell/ghc-paths:=[profile?]
=dev-haskell/xhtml-3000.2*:=[profile?]
- >=dev-lang/ghc-7.6.1:="
+ >=dev-lang/ghc-7.6:= <dev-lang/ghc-7.7:="
DEPEND="${RDEPEND}
>=dev-haskell/cabal-1.14"
RESTRICT="test" # avoid depends on QC
-CABAL_EXTRA_BUILD_FLAGS="--ghc-options=-rtsopts"
+CABAL_EXTRA_BUILD_FLAGS+=" --ghc-options=-rtsopts"
src_prepare() {
# we would like to avoid happy and alex depends
1.6 dev-haskell/haddock/haddock-2.13.2-r1.ebuild
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.13.2-r1.ebuild?rev=1.6&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.13.2-r1.ebuild?rev=1.6&content-type=text/plain
diff :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/haddock-2.13.2-r1.ebuild?r1=1.5&r2=1.6
Index: haddock-2.13.2-r1.ebuild
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.13.2-r1.ebuild,v
retrieving revision 1.5
retrieving revision 1.6
diff -u -r1.5 -r1.6
--- haddock-2.13.2-r1.ebuild 22 Sep 2013 06:44:28 -0000 1.5
+++ haddock-2.13.2-r1.ebuild 1 Aug 2015 21:42:46 -0000 1.6
@@ -1,6 +1,6 @@
-# Copyright 1999-2013 Gentoo Foundation
+#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header:
/var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.13.2-r1.ebuild,v 1.5
2013/09/22 06:44:28 ago Exp $
+# $Header:
/var/cvsroot/gentoo-x86/dev-haskell/haddock/haddock-2.13.2-r1.ebuild,v 1.6
2015/08/01 21:42:46 slyfox Exp $
EAPI=5
@@ -23,13 +23,13 @@
RDEPEND="dev-haskell/ghc-paths:=[profile?]
=dev-haskell/xhtml-3000.2*:=[profile?]
- >=dev-lang/ghc-7.6.1:="
+ >=dev-lang/ghc-7.6:= <dev-lang/ghc-7.7:="
DEPEND="${RDEPEND}
>=dev-haskell/cabal-1.14"
RESTRICT="test" # avoid depends on QC
-CABAL_EXTRA_BUILD_FLAGS="--ghc-options=-rtsopts"
+CABAL_EXTRA_BUILD_FLAGS+=" --ghc-options=-rtsopts"
src_prepare() {
# we would like to avoid happy and alex depends
1.118 dev-haskell/haddock/ChangeLog
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/ChangeLog?rev=1.118&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/ChangeLog?rev=1.118&content-type=text/plain
diff :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-haskell/haddock/ChangeLog?r1=1.117&r2=1.118
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-haskell/haddock/ChangeLog,v
retrieving revision 1.117
retrieving revision 1.118
diff -u -r1.117 -r1.118
--- ChangeLog 1 Aug 2015 21:23:32 -0000 1.117
+++ ChangeLog 1 Aug 2015 21:42:46 -0000 1.118
@@ -1,6 +1,10 @@
# ChangeLog for dev-haskell/haddock
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-haskell/haddock/ChangeLog,v 1.117
2015/08/01 21:23:32 slyfox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-haskell/haddock/ChangeLog,v 1.118
2015/08/01 21:42:46 slyfox Exp $
+
+ 01 Aug 2015; Sergei Trofimovich <[email protected]> haddock-2.10.0-r2.ebuild,
+ haddock-2.13.1-r2.ebuild, haddock-2.13.2-r1.ebuild:
+ Put upper bound on ghc version for older packages.
*haddock-2.16.1 (01 Aug 2015)